The watch-making industry utilises laser marking processes for part identification and traceability, as well as laser engraving for aesthetic design purposes. In the past, a watchmaker may have mechanically engraved or etched his work by hand. Today, laser machines are the obvious choice for high-quality and intricate work. Part numbers, serial numbers and charge labelling, as well as data matrix codes, decretive logos and graphics are all examples of applications for watch parts. The laser is the perfect tool due to its ability to mark the smallest and most delicate designs quickly and efficiently.
There are many small details that are prevalent to clockwork prototype construction. A very wide variety of materials are used, and the individual parts that are manufactured are constantly changing and improving. Sometimes, materials, which are uncommon for watchmakers (wood and acrylic) need to be processed alongside the typical metal engravings. Here, Trotec offers the perfect solution – flatbed lasers in the Speedy Flexx range. These machines use two laser sources (Fiber and CO2) at the same time, so marking any material becomes quick and simple.
